Job Purpose
Providing a statutory service, the Post 16 Tracking Team supports the work of Solihull Council’s Employment and Skills.
Main Responsibilites
•Contribute to tracking the participation in education, training and employment of young people through direct contact via telephone, text, email, and door knocks.
•Accurate data inputting to the bespoke IO database, from information gained from tracking activities and on lists provided by schools, colleges and training providers.
•Signpost young people and parents/carers to information on participation pathways, relevant education and training, and national and local support agencies.
•Build and maintain working relationships with internal and external agencies including opportunity providers, support agencies, schools, colleges and relevant SMBC colleagues to gather accurate and current information.
•Continually review and actively seek ways of improving processes to ensure that they are effective and efficient.
•Actively contribute to working groups and project teams as appropriate.
•Make use of corporate social media – Facebook and twitter as a communication tool
•Support with the production of statistics and related reports.
•Quality check reports before sending to internal and external agencies.
•Assist in general clerical duties relevant to the Employment & Skills Team as required using applications such as Word, Excel, Outlook and IO (the bespoke database).
